Overview

Ledger Live is Ledger’s official desktop and mobile application that connects to Ledger hardware wallets (Ledger Nano S Plus, Ledger Nano X, and others) and provides a user-friendly interface for managing cryptocurrencies. Ledger Live helps you initialize your device, create or restore a recovery phrase, install blockchain-specific apps, add accounts, send and receive assets, and access supported services like staking or swaps. The security model keeps private keys on the hardware device while Ledger Live handles account presentation, transaction construction, and broadcasting.

Step 3 — Initialize your Ledger device

When you power on a new Ledger device, follow the on-device instructions to either Set up as new device or Restore from recovery phrase. If setting up as new:

  1. Create a device PIN directly on the hardware wallet—this prevents unauthorized local access.
  2. The device will display your recovery phrase (typically 24 words) one word at a time. Write them down in order on the recovery sheet included in the box or another secure medium.
  3. Confirm your recovery phrase on the device when prompted to ensure accuracy.

If restoring, input the words when requested on the device. Never type your phrase into a computer or mobile app.

Step 5 — Install blockchain apps

Ledger devices use small applications for each blockchain protocol (Bitcoin, Ethereum, Solana, etc.). Install the apps you need through Ledger Live’s Manager tab. Note that device storage is finite — remove unused apps to free space. Installing an app does not expose your private keys; the app simply enables the device to understand and sign transactions for that blockchain.

Step 6 — Add accounts

After you install the necessary apps, go to the Accounts tab in Ledger Live and add accounts for each currency. Ledger Live will derive addresses from your device and display balances. For tokens and derivatives, ensure the underlying chain app (e.g., Ethereum) is installed and up to date.

Security best practices

  • Never share your recovery phrase: It’s the single source of truth for account recovery. Ledger staff will never ask for it.
  • Verify addresses on the device: Always confirm the destination address on your Ledger device screen before approving a transaction.
  • Use firmware updates: Apply firmware updates when available via Ledger Live; they may contain security patches and feature improvements.
  • Store backups securely: Use fireproof and waterproof options for long-term storage of recovery material.
  • Be cautious of phishing: Only use official Ledger domains and double-check links in emails or messages.

Troubleshooting common issues

  • Device not recognized: Try a different USB cable or port; reboot the computer and device. For Bluetooth issues with Nano X, ensure the device is paired in your OS Bluetooth settings.
  • App installation failed: Free up space by removing unused apps and try again.
  • Missing funds: Ensure you added the correct account and network. For tokens, ensure the token is supported and the corresponding app is installed.
  • Recovery concerns: If you suspect your recovery phrase was exposed, move funds to a new wallet generated with a secure device immediately.

Frequently asked questions

Can I use Ledger Live without a Ledger device?

Ledger Live requires a Ledger hardware wallet for signing transactions. Some read-only features, like viewing portfolio or watching addresses, may be available in certain configurations, but all signing operations require the device.

What if I lose my device?

If your device is lost or stolen, you can recover your accounts using your recovery phrase on another Ledger device or any compatible wallet that supports the same recovery standard (BIP39/BIP44/BIP32, depending on configuration).

Is the recovery phrase 24 words?

Ledger devices typically use a 24-word recovery phrase, but some older models or specific recovery processes may use different lengths. Follow on-device instructions during setup and keep the exact phrase as provided.
